Output 31fdb7380d399f577303518f71f019886205375cb110c5220065676729cab848:0

value
1013876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aa49a959196c22a1adee4fdf0dfe8ffdb663978 OP_EQUAL
address
3CsVYpfp9uovpsStNi1uCo1AHAYkWLR8Vr
transaction
31fdb7380d399f577303518f71f019886205375cb110c5220065676729cab848
spent
true